A luxurious friendly match between Barcelona and Inter Miami, which the Americans refused
Messi’s long-awaited farewell to the Catalan club looks set to have to wait, although this summer provided the perfect opportunity for the Inter Miami international to play against his former club, AS.com reports.
Barcelona are planning a tour of the US in preparation for the 2024-25 La Liga season and were hoping to face a team of former players Messi, Suarez, Alba and Busquets.
However, the match has a minimal chance of being played due to the busy schedule the MLS team has at this time.
Talks between the Spaniards and Inter suggested the friendly would be played in July, after the Copa América and Euro tournament had finished, but then the Americans are busy preparing for the League Cup, a competition they won last season.
Moreover, the chances of Messi performing were minimal as the Argentine got more days off after the Copa America.
